Elena has written 3 sports books for kids. One book is about soccer, one is about baseball, and one is about basketball. Elena has sold a total of 3,017 of the books in local bookstores. She sold 3 times as many copies of the soccer book as the baseball book. She sold the same number of copies of the basketball book as the soccer book. How many copies of the soccer book has she sold?

Answers

Answer:

1293 soccer books

Step-by-step explanation:

The tricky part about questions like this is: how do I assign variables to the three types of book?

You get a clue from the sentence, "She sold 3 times as many copies of the soccer book as the baseball book."  The number of soccer books is being described by referring TO the number of baseball books.  Pick a variable and assign it to the item being REFERRED TO!

x = number of baseball books

Then  3x = number of soccer books.  The number of basketball books is the same, so 3x = number of basketball books.  Here's the list...

x = number of baseball books

3x = number of soccer books

3x = number of basketball books

The total of these is 3017, so

x + 3x + 3x = 3017

7x = 3017

x = 431

Ah!  But don't forget to look back at the question:  it asks for the number of SOCCER books!  That's 3x, so 3(431) = 1293.

sammy is eleven less than five times Jaime's age. if the sum of their ages is 55, how old is each girl? please help me if i dont get this done soon moms gonna be super mad

Answers

Answer:

Jaime = 11

Sammy = 44

Step-by-step explanation:

It is given that Sammy is eleven less than five times Jaime's age. Use parameter (S) to represent Sammy's age, and parameter (J) to represent Jaime's age. Form an equation based on this given information:

S = 5J - 11

It is given that the sum of the two girl's ages is (55), use an equation to represent this.

S + J = 55

Substitute in the expression for the value of (S) in terms of (J),

(5J - 11) + J = 55

Simplify,

6J - 11 = 55

Inverse operations,

6J - 11 = 55

6J = 66

J = 11

Backsolve for the value of (S), substitute in the value of (J) into the equation for (S) and solve,

S = 5(J) - 11

S = 5(11) -11

S = 55 - 11

S = 44
